Can you repair your windows yourself?
Window problems can arise for many reasons. window doctor bexley can be resolved by a DIYer while others require professional assistance. Before you can choose a solution, you must first identify the issue and determine if it can or cannot be fixed.
One of the most common window problems is condensation. Condensation can cause glass to peel or crack due to the water that has entered the windows. Also, the insulated window unit (IGU) is prone to being damaged. Most often, the reason for water infiltration is caused by faulty exterior window casings, or insufficient guttering. It may be necessary to replace all of the windows in the event that the glass panes are broken.
Windows are made up of a variety of components, including glass panes, sash, glazier points, glazing strips, and wood molding. The components can be removed to access the panes. You'll need thick cut-proof gloves as well as safety glasses for the job.
Broken windows can invite pests and insects into your home. It is important to take care of windows that are damaged. This could result in increased energy costs and decrease the comfort of your home. In some instances replacement of the panes or sash might be enough to solve the problem.
Wood rot may also occur around windows, especially in the case of windows that are open to moisture. The rotting is caused by humid and wet weather conditions, or direct contact with the outside. Wood rot repair may be as difficult as fixing a damaged window.

Window glass can be repaired or replaced. But, it's essential to have the proper materials. You can do it yourself or get an expert to remove the old panes and clean them before putting in the new ones. To ensure that they fit perfectly be sure to measure the panes thoroughly and then apply fresh putty.
It isn't easy to replace glass because you'll need to determine the width and height of each pane. Make sure that the new glass is at least one half inch shorter in all directions. It is possible to remove more than one pane, based on the size of your window. If you are replacing a multi-paned window it is also necessary to take off the sash.
In certain instances it might be more cost-effective to have an expert replace windows. But, there are many regular repairs that anyone could do. You can use a heat gun to loosen old putty. However, you will require a scraper for scraping the old glass and removing any new putty.
Other items you'll require are new windows, glazier points as well as painter's tape. You'll also need to use drills and screwdrivers to attach the new window to the frame.
The particulars of your home will determine whether you choose to have a professional replace or do it yourself. Certain basic repairs are easy to carry out, however more serious issues require the attention of a professional.
Why you should you replace your glass?
Double glazing lasts around 15 years on average. However, it can last longer depending on the style of your home, the weather and the quality materials employed. Double-glazing windows can be replaced if you wish to enhance the appearance of your home and make it more energy-efficient and warmer.
Double-glazing windows not only help keep heat in your home and increase the property's value. In fact, some modern models are 70 percent more energy efficient than standard double-glazed units. In addition, adding insulation to your glass will also help to reduce noise in your home and reduce your household's annual energy use.
Double-glazed windows consist of two panes, each with an air-filled cavity. This gas that acts as an insulator, also called argon is non-toxic and has no odor. It can be combined with a specific coating to create insulation that retains more heat.
Even the top-quality windows will eventually get worn out. That is why many people prefer to replace their older ones with new ones. One of the biggest advantages of double-glazed windows is that they are less likely to be a victim for burglars. By upgrading your windows, it is possible to guard yourself against opportunistic burglars and increase the value your home.
You can make your home more comfortable with new windows. There are many options that can help you reduce the outside noise and increase the security at home.

The glazing company of choice for DA6
If you're considering installing double glazing, you'll need to select a company with an excellent reputation and good customer base. This is important as many companies have been known to cause trouble and have poor installations. There are a myriad of alternatives.
The first thing you should look for is a company which offers a warranty. Double glazing warranties should last at minimum 10 years. Some warranties are even extended for life. If you're looking to be assured be sure that the company you select offers a warranty.
It is also an excellent idea to check if the business has an FENSA backed guarantee. A FENSA-backed warranty means that the company is in compliance with building regulations. If you're unhappy with the windows you have installed ensure that they have cooling-off time.
It's an excellent idea for customers to read reviews of companies prior to making a final decision. Trustpilot and Consumers Confidence are two sites that allow you to do this. These sites offer a wealth information about different companies, including their ratings as well as what customers have to say.
You should also determine if the business you're choosing has a wide range of styles, designs and materials. You could choose uPVC or aluminum if you want something that is more efficient.
While you're examining the details of your new windows you should be sure to think about your budget. You can choose the best window for you by looking at the costs and payment options.
It is also important to whether the company offers a multi-lock system. You can't just use screws to tighten the hinges, you'll need to have more security measures put in place like an locking system to ensure that windows stay closed.
